Operações assíncronas

Para reduzir o impacto adverso no desempenho, Adobe Experience Manger Assets processa de modo assíncrono determinadas operações de ativos de longa duração e de uso intensivo de recursos. O processamento assíncrono envolve enfileirar várias tarefas e, eventualmente, executá-las de forma serial, dependendo da disponibilidade de recursos do sistema. Essas operações incluem:

  • Exclusão de muitos ativos.
  • Movimentação de muitos ativos ou ativos com muitas referências.
  • Exportar e importar metadados de ativos em massa.

Você pode visualização o status de tarefas assíncronas da página Status do trabalho assíncrono.

OBSERVAÇÃO

Por padrão, as tarefas Assets são executadas em paralelo. Se N for o número de núcleos da CPU, N/2 o tarefa poderá ser executado em paralelo, por padrão. Para usar configurações personalizadas para a fila de tarefas, modifique a configuração Fila padrão de operação assíncrona do Console da Web. Para obter mais informações, consulte Configurações de fila.

Monitore o status das operações assíncronas

Sempre que Assets processar uma operação de forma assíncrona, você receberá uma notificação em sua Experience Manager Caixa de entrada e por um email. Para visualizar o status das operações assíncronas em detalhes, acesse a página Status do trabalho assíncrono.

  1. Na interface Experience Manager, clique em Operações > Tarefas.

  2. Na página Status do trabalho assíncrono, verifique os detalhes das operações.

    Status e detalhes de operações assíncronas

    Para verificar o progresso de uma operação, consulte a coluna Status. Dependendo do progresso, será exibido um dos seguintes status:

    • Ativo: a operação está sendo processada.
    • Sucesso: a operação foi concluída.
    • Falha ou Erro: não foi possível processar a operação.
    • Agendado: a operação está programada para ser processada mais tarde.
  3. Para interromper uma operação ativa, selecione-a na lista e clique em Parar ícone de parada na barra de ferramentas.

  4. Para visualização de detalhes adicionais, por exemplo, descrição e registros, selecione a operação e clique em Abrir open_icon na barra de ferramentas. A página de detalhes da tarefa é exibida.

    Detalhes de uma tarefa de importação de metadados

  5. Para excluir a operação da lista, selecione Excluir na barra de ferramentas. Para baixar os detalhes em um arquivo CSV, clique em Baixar.

    OBSERVAÇÃO

    Não é possível excluir uma tarefa se seu status estiver ativo ou na fila.

Limpar tarefas concluídas

Experience Manager Assets executa uma tarefa de expurgação todos os dias às 100 horas para excluir tarefas assíncronas concluídas com mais de um dia de idade.

Você pode modificar a programação para a tarefa de expurgação e a duração para a qual os detalhes das tarefas concluídas são retidos antes de serem excluídas. Você também pode configurar o número máximo de tarefas concluídas para as quais os detalhes são retidos a qualquer momento.

  1. Na interface Experience Manager, clique em Ferramentas > Operações > Console Web.

  2. Abra a tarefa Adobe CQ DAM Async Jobs Expurgar Programados.

  3. Especifique o número limite de dias após o qual as tarefas concluídas são excluídas e o número máximo de tarefas para as quais os detalhes são mantidos no histórico. Salve as alterações.

    Configuração para agendar a remoção de tarefas assíncronas

Configurar limite para operações de exclusão assíncronas

Se o número de ativos ou pastas a serem excluídos exceder o número limite definido, a operação de exclusão será executada de forma assíncrona.

  1. Na interface Experience Manager, clique em Ferramentas > Operações > Console Web.

  2. No Console Web, abra a configuração Async Delete Operation Job Processing.

  3. Na caixa Número limite de ativos, especifique os números limite para excluir ativos, pastas ou referências de forma assíncrona. Salve as alterações.

    Definir o limite para a tarefa excluir ativos

Configurar limite para operações de movimentação assíncronas

Se o número de ativos, pastas ou referências a serem movidos exceder o número limite definido, a operação de movimentação será executada de forma assíncrona.

  1. Na interface Experience Manager, clique em Ferramentas > Operações > Console Web.

  2. No Console Web, abra a configuração Async Move Operation Job Processing.

  3. Na caixa Número limite de ativos/referências, especifique os números limite para mover ativos, pastas ou referências de forma assíncrona. Salve as alterações.

    Definir o limite de tarefa para mover ativos

Nesta página